About this app
A FOSS tool for everyday users, enthusiasts, and professionals to gather mobile cell data in a simple yet precise way. Built from scratch with Flutter, following Material guidelines to blend in with system applications.
Features
- Clean display of key network metrics across all cellular technologies up to 5G NR. - Custom cell database import in .ntm and .clf v3 formats. - Map page powered by OpenStreetMap showing nearby active cell towers from the current network. - Drive test recording: record radio signal strength, network usability, and network info during trips, and replay them later inside the app or externally via built-in .kml and .csv conversion. - Built-in network speed test with support for LibreSpeed, OpenSpeedTest, and custom backends. - Detailed event log capturing cell handoffs, frequency band adjustments, and other real-time network changes. - Opt-in notifications for selected network events. - Optional background service for event and trip logging with a status notification showing live metrics. - Shortcuts to Android field testing menus: Android phone information, Samsung ServiceMode, MTK Engineer mode, Huawei ProjectMenu, and MIUI BandMode. - Full dual SIM support with concurrent data monitoring. - Advanced data preprocessing and postprocessing to filter bad data from Android's Telephony API and merge information into a single SIM data object. - Export of event logs and map trip logs to text files.
Analytics
Optional and opt-in only: anonymous crash dumps and error logs, non-linkable to the user, collected via the open-source Sentry Dart SDK and stored on Bugsink, an EU-managed open-source Sentry alternative.
